What's The Definition Of Britannic?

Britannic in American English
of Great Britain; British
adjective: of Britain; British
noun: P-Celtic, esp. that part either spoken in Britain, as Welsh and Cornish, or descended from the P-Celtic speech of Britain, as Breton; Brythonic

Britannic in British English
adjective: of Britain; British (esp in the phrases His or Her Britannic Majesty)
